Compare commits

...

2 Commits

Author SHA1 Message Date
5521870f0a build 2025-10-28 20:19:38 +01:00
2c53dfd049 build 2025-10-28 20:18:03 +01:00

View File

@@ -167,15 +167,9 @@ backups = {
}
},
"m-server":{
"login": "root@m-server.home.lan",
"jobs": {
"docker_data":{
"source":"/share/docker_data/",
"exclude":"",
"active":True
},
"fail2ban":{
"source":"/etc/fail2ban/",
"source":"/media/m-server/docker_data/",
"exclude":"",
"active":True
}
@@ -199,10 +193,6 @@ BACKUP_FS = "/media/backup/"
BACKUP_HOST = "amd.home.lan"
#BACKUP_HOST = "morefine.home.lan"
logging.info("Test connection")
hm = socket.gethostbyaddr(BACKUP_HOST)
logging.info(_RESTORE)
def send_mqtt_message(topic,msg,qos=0,retain=False):
client2 = mqtt.Client()
client2.username_pw_set("jaydee", "jaydee1")
@@ -532,9 +522,8 @@ def backup_job(pl):
SOURCE_DIR = backups[host]["jobs"][b]["source"]
now = datetime.datetime.now()
BACKUP_HOST = backups[host]["login"]
BACKUP_DEVICE = "/mnt/raid"
BACKUP_DIR = f"{BACKUP_HOST}:{SOURCE_DIR}"
BACKUP_DIR = f"{SOURCE_DIR}"
BACKUP_ROOT = f"{BACKUP_DEVICE}/backup/{host}/{b}"
DATETIME = now.strftime("%Y-%m-%d_%H-%M-%S")
@@ -549,9 +538,6 @@ def backup_job(pl):
msg = {"mode":_MODE, "status":"started","bak_name":"complete","host":host,"cur_job":b,"start_time":STARTTIME,"end_time":"in progress","progress":0,"finished":",".join(finished)}
client2.publish(topic, json.dumps(msg),qos=0, retain=True)
cmnd = "mkdir -p " + NEW_BACKUP_DIR
logging.info(cmnd)